1. Choose a Niche or Genre

While you can write any type of story, having a consistent genre (e.g. horror, romance, sci-fi, fantasy, mystery) helps build a loyal readership. Some popular niches include:

  • Flash fiction (under 1,000 words)

  • Microfiction (under 300 words)

  • Episodic stories or serials

  • Fan fiction (based on existing worlds)

Tip: Pick something you love writing — your passion will show.

3. Set Up Your Blog with a CMS

Use a content management system like WordPress for easy publishing and customization. Choose a clean, responsive theme suitable for reading, such as:

  • Hemingway

  • Astra

  • Writee

Install key plugins for:

  • SEO (Rank Math or Yoast)

  • Social sharing (AddToAny)

  • Spam protection (Akismet)

  • Backups and security

4. Plan Your Content and Posting Schedule

Create a content calendar with:

  • Weekly or bi-weekly short story posts

  • Behind-the-scenes or “author notes” entries

  • Themed months (e.g. October = horror stories)

Consistency is more important than frequency — post regularly.

5. Write Stories That Hook Readers

Each story should:

  • Begin with a strong hook (first paragraph)

  • Build tension or curiosity

  • End with a twist, resolution, or thought-provoking conclusion

Keep your audience in mind. Use cliffhangers for episodic stories and experiment with style and tone.

6. Engage Your Readers

  • Enable comments and respond to feedback.

  • Add polls or ask questions at the end of each post.

  • Offer story prompts or writing challenges.

Encourage readers to subscribe to your newsletter or RSS feed to stay updated.

7. Promote Your Blog

Use social media platforms like:

  • Instagram (for visual story teasers)

  • Twitter/X (for microfiction and quotes)

  • Reddit (share in writing communities like r/shortstories)

Submit your blog to directories or communities like Bloglovin, Medium, or Vocal.
